Good score that Malmir - well played! Should be in with a shot of the title with that - exact same score of 74% (ignoring racial bonuses) won it last year. Should be interesting again though, some other impressive scores being notched up - Strider in particular is going very nicely!
On number of squads have to say I have rather mixed feelings about the current season. I understand why Christer has allowed repeat entries - to maximise games played in the Box and in a sense that is a good thing. But personally I really don't like the fact that those coaches who have more free time get extra shots at the title. By analogy Man Utd don't get two or more goes at the FA Cup because they are rich do they? Fummbl is great in that you can't pay money to gain any advantage whatsoever, but having the alternative currency of extra time should not give you any advantage either. Ah well - it's Christer's site and a great one, and of course if those are the rules that's what we will play by. No fault of any coaches and if you can get in two seasons then good for you (I definitely won't be able to as you've probably guessed)! Good to see lots of games played recently though.
As an alternative for next season, it would be fairer if each coach could only have one tilt at the Trophy, then if folks want to play more games then maybe there could be a second competition - call it the Shield or whatever - for teams that have already played in one or more previous seasons of the Trophy. This competition at higher TVs would provide something different, and prevent the proliferation of claw/Mb chaos sides at higher TVs (where they are more of a problem anyway). Also it would keep a lot of the teams going - have heard several coaches say it's a shame they have 'redundant' BBT teams which they don't play anymore, this would use these again. Just a suggestion anyway |

So, how did you guys decide on the races you were going to play? Last time, I had gone for something I felt to be an "optimal" build but I couldn't really stay motivated throughout the trophy, did complete 111 games but too much of it felt like a chore. So I went for more variety this time. That also ruled out all the races I played last time, which was most of tier 2.
>> Took Flings for the giggles and also to take the pressure off in terms of overall score. That meant enough points to get three decent races and hopefully more wins to keep me motivated.
>> Therefore, took Darkies next, d'uh. My favourite race anyway, suits my play style, plus a bargain at 2 points, no brainer.
>> Needed another tier 2 roster, the only ones I hadn't played yet were Humans and Renegades, therefore easily settled on Humans, clearly stronger in the format, plus I do like them, plus, good meta with all those Elves and Stunties that the Trophy brings to the Box.
>> That left me with 3 points so could have one tier 1 race. Had been planning to go Undead (strongest race according to stats and I'm also not too bad with them), but then I just didn't feel like it, it just seemed too boring, plus, my expectations would be too high with them. So took Chaos Dwarves instead. How are Cheese Dorfs less boring than Undead, you ask? Well I think in the format they are, plus I just fancied them. I felt they were a little underrated in the stats so maybe if I got a good run I might have a chance at the racial lead, which would be pretty cool.
So, yeah, that was my reasoning. Plan is working so far, I have 20% completed and still super motivated! |
